Cyst of the medullary conus

Last revised by Henry Knipe on 1 Jan 2024

Cyst of the medullary conus is a rare benign ependymal cyst of the conus medullaris which probably relates to abnormal persistence and cystic dilatation of the ventriculus terminalis or "5th ventricle".

Clinical presentation

This entity can be symptomatic or can present in adulthood with bladder or bowel sphincter disturbance.    

Differential diagnosis

Filar cysts occur in a similar region but are below the conus medullaris.
